The Republican lawmaker is expected to introduce the legislation Friday, which will ban federal funds for states and local governments that ban people from having dogs as pets. Although no state has an outright ban on dogs, some places ban certain breeds.
"You're allowed to practice your faith in privacy and in freedom, but it ends when you tell me what I have to believe," Fine said on the "Just The News, No Noise" TV show. "You don't get to do that in America. There are 57 countries in the world where you can go be Sharia compliant and not have a dog. It's my job to make sure we don't become number 58 and with a guy like [New York City Mayor Zohran] Mamdani, we have to be worried about that."
